BIPO Review

BIPO is a Singapore-headquartered global payroll and EOR platform founded in 2010 with 170+ country coverage and deep Southeast Asian expertise. Serving 3,300+ clients and managing 460,000+ employees, BIPO combines EOR services with a proprietary HRMS suite and is Workday Gold Certified — making it the strongest APAC-native payroll and EOR platform for enterprises expanding across Asia.

Employer of Record (EOR)

BIPO provides EOR services across 170+ countries with a deep focus on Asia-Pacific markets. The platform handles compliant employment, payroll, statutory benefits, and tax filing. In APAC markets — particularly Singapore, China, Hong Kong, Malaysia, Thailand, and the Philippines — BIPO operates through local teams with native compliance expertise. Outside APAC, coverage is primarily through partner networks.

Global Payroll

BIPO manages payroll for 460,000+ employees across 3,300+ clients, making it one of the largest payroll processors in the APAC region. The platform supports multi-country payroll consolidation, automated tax calculations, and statutory reporting. Payroll is processed by in-country teams with local expertise in each jurisdiction.

HRMS Suite

A proprietary HRMS is included with EOR services, covering employee records, leave management, claims processing, time and attendance, and basic performance management. The system provides a unified view across countries and supports multi-language interfaces for APAC markets.

Enterprise Integrations

BIPO is Workday Gold Certified and also integrates with Oracle HCM and SAP SuccessFactors. This makes it the strongest APAC-native choice for enterprises already running these platforms. The integration depth enables seamless data flow between BIPO payroll and existing enterprise HR systems.

Compliance & Reporting

Deep regulatory expertise across Southeast Asia, Greater China, and ANZ markets. BIPO handles complex statutory requirements including CPF calculations in Singapore, MPF in Hong Kong, social insurance in China, and superannuation in Australia. Reporting covers payroll journals, statutory submissions, and workforce analytics.

Onboarding & Setup

Users report a managed onboarding process with local teams guiding setup in APAC markets. The experience is described as hands-on and thorough, particularly for complex jurisdictions like China and Singapore where statutory registration requirements are extensive.

APAC Expertise

The strongest positive theme across reviews is BIPO's deep understanding of Southeast Asian compliance — CPF in Singapore, MPF in Hong Kong, social insurance in China. Users hiring across APAC consistently praise the in-country expertise and native-language support.

Platform & Integrations

The Workday Gold Certification is valued by enterprise clients already running Workday. The proprietary HRMS is functional for core needs. Some users note that the platform interface feels less polished than modern EOR tools and that feature development is slower.

Customer Support

Support is rated positively for APAC markets where BIPO has local teams. Users hiring outside Asia report less consistent support quality, which aligns with the partner-network model used in non-APAC countries.

Value for Money

Pricing is not published and requires custom quotes, which frustrates some buyers during the evaluation phase. Users who proceed generally find the pricing reasonable for the APAC compliance depth, but the lack of transparency is a recurring complaint.

BIPO vs Multiplier

Both have APAC roots — BIPO in Singapore (2010) and Multiplier in Singapore (2020). Multiplier offers transparent flat pricing at $400/month with 150+ owned entities globally. BIPO requires custom quotes and relies on partners outside APAC. Multiplier is better for global mid-market hiring with clear pricing; BIPO suits enterprises needing deep APAC payroll expertise with Workday Gold integration.

BIPO vs Deel

Deel offers 300+ integrations, transparent $599/month pricing, and 250 owned entities globally. BIPO offers deeper APAC-native compliance expertise and Workday Gold Certification but lacks published pricing. Choose Deel for a global self-service platform; choose BIPO for enterprise APAC payroll consolidation with Workday integration.

BIPO vs Papaya Global

Both serve enterprise clients with multi-country payroll consolidation. Papaya focuses on AI-powered payroll analytics across 160+ countries. BIPO focuses on APAC depth with local teams in 30+ Asian markets. Choose Papaya for global payroll intelligence dashboards; choose BIPO for hands-on Southeast Asian compliance expertise.

BIPO vs Remote

Remote operates 100% owned entities across 90+ countries with strong IP protection at $599/month. BIPO covers 170+ countries but uses partners outside APAC. Remote is the better choice for IP-sensitive global hiring; BIPO suits enterprises already running Workday that need deep APAC payroll management.

Custom-Quoted EOR Pricing for APAC Expansion

BIPO's pricing is structured around a per-employee monthly fee, with costs varying by country and service tier. Pricing is available on request and not published. Setup fees and termination costs apply in most markets. Volume discounts are available for larger enterprise teams. Always confirm the final quote directly, as local taxes and compliance costs may be added.

SWITCHING

Switching to or from BIPO?

Switching to BIPO

BIPO provides managed migration support for companies moving APAC employees from another EOR provider. The local teams in each Asian market handle contract novation, statutory re-registration, and payroll cutover with native-language compliance expertise. Migration timelines depend on the number of APAC countries involved.

Switching away from BIPO

When moving away from BIPO, key considerations include extracting payroll history and statutory documents from BIPO's proprietary HRMS, coordinating Workday integration disconnection if applicable, and managing the transition in APAC markets where partner networks (outside core APAC) may have different novation procedures.

Questions to ask before switching any EOR

Before switching to or from any EOR provider, confirm: Will there be a gap in employment or benefits coverage? Who handles employee communication during transition? Are there overlapping billing periods? Will payroll history transfer in a usable format? Are there country-specific restrictions on contract novation?
